Bitcoin Price Prediction as Crypto Market Selling Continues – What’s Going On?
0
SHARES
7
VIEWS
ShareShareShareShareShare

Amid a continued selling trend in the crypto market,  Bitcoin’s value experiences notable fluctuations. As of now, the live price of Bitcoin stands at $25,090, with an impressive 24-hour trading volume of $14.7 billion. 

However, despite its market dominance—reflected in its #1 ranking on CoinMarketCap—Bitcoin has seen a dip of nearly 3% in the past 24 hours. 

The currency’s live market capitalization is a whopping $488.83 billion, and out of its maximum supply of 21 million BTC coins, 19,482,656 BTC are currently in circulation. 

The pressing question on everyone’s mind is: What’s causing this market upheaval?

Bitcoin Price Prediction 

Delving into the technical analysis of Bitcoin, it is evident that the premier cryptocurrency has recently witnessed a stark downturn.

Specifically, it has breached a significant triple bottom support at the $25,400 level—a benchmark that had been underscored by the triple bottom pattern visible on the 4-hour timeframe. 

The presence of the “Three Black Crows” candlestick pattern on this same timeframe further augments the prospects of a continued bearish trend.

Presently, Bitcoin is navigating the oversold territory. Oscillator indicators, like the Relative Strength Index (RSI), are lingering below the 30 mark, which typically suggests seller exhaustion. 

Such a dynamic often paves the way for a brief bullish correction prior to a potential resumption of the downtrend. Concurrently, the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ator has entrenched itself in the sell zone, with histograms forming below the zero line—another beacon of bearish sentiment. 

The 50-day Exponential Moving Average (EMA) is positioned around $25,500, and with Bitcoin currently priced at approximately $25,200, and consistently trading below the 50 EMA, the bearish bias remains robust.

Bitcoin Price Chart – Source: Tradingview

From this technical analysis point, Bitcoin is poised to encounter resistance around the $25,400 level. 

A modest bullish correction up to the $25,600 level might merely be a precursor to a deeper dive, potentially targeting the next support level at $24,800. 

If Bitcoin was to decisively undercut the $24,800 level, the subsequent support is anticipated around the $24,000 mark. It’s also worth noting a descending trend line, currently posing as a significant barrier around the $25,600 mark. 

However, should Bitcoin muster a bullish breakout above this line, the gates might open for a rally towards the $26,400 level or even as high as $46,000.

In summation, the $25,600 level emerges as a critical juncture, likely serving as today’s pivotal point in the trading landscape.
